Understand Common Plumbing Issues and Their Costs

Plumbing issues can be both frustrating and expensive. Understanding common problems and their associated costs is a crucial first step in preventing costly disasters. Leaks, for instance, may seem minor but can lead to significant water waste and sky-high utility bills over time. Clogged drains and pipes can cause similar financial strain, not to mention the potential for severe damage if left unattended.
Regular maintenance by premium plumbing services can help mitigate these issues. Professional inspections and routine cleaning can identify problems early on, preventing small repairs from turning into major crises. Inspect Pipes for Leaks or Corrosion

Regular maintenance is key to preventing costly plumbing disasters. One crucial step is inspecting pipes for leaks or corrosion. Even subtle signs of damage can lead to bigger issues down the line, causing water waste and potential structural problems in your home. A professional from a premium plumbing company can help with this process by identifying weak spots and providing solutions before they escalate.
Consider scheduling periodic checks, especially for critical components like water heaters, which often require expert installation and warranty support. Replace Old Parts Before They Fail

Regular maintenance is key to preventing costly plumbing disasters. One crucial aspect often overlooked is replacing old parts before they fail. Many homeowners tend to ignore minor leaks, slow drains, or outdated fixtures, assuming they’re just cosmetic issues. However, these could be early signs of larger problems brewing beneath your luxury bathroom plumbing.
Upgrading to premium plumbing components isn’t just about aesthetics; it involves ensuring the longevity and efficiency of your sewer line replacement. Regularly inspecting and replacing worn-out parts can prevent blockages, leaks, and even foundation damage caused by unstable pipes.
